    LeRoy Green became a sparring partner for hire, as his professional career was going nowhere as a 'trial-horse'.
    He was one of those 'mob-connected' fighters, whose contract was always sold from one
    'small-time connected guy' to another.
    First in Kansas City, then to New York, then back to Kansas City, then to Minnesota, then back to Kansas City,
    then back to New York, then to Denver, then back to Chicago.
    In May 1964, his 10-year contract expired.
    He then hooked up with Archie Pirolli, Sonny Liston's camp manager.

    He did set some kind of record, by going 120+ Rounds with Sonny Liston in
    1964, in Denver.

    And he was never floored.

    LeRoy Green

    Was something of a pretty good amateur.
    Won the 1953 Greater Kansas City Golden Gloves at 160 lbs.
    Also several 1953 amateur tournaments, including the January 1954 Kansas State Open.
    Track records show him with an amateur record of 66-15

    Turned pro at age 22, and was expected to go far.
    Won his first 5-bouts, before being upset in Kansas City, in December 1954.
    His contract was then sold to a New York connected-manager,
    where he fought in 1955.

    Was also a Sonny Liston sparring partner for his first fight with Floyd Patterson
    in Chicago, Septermber 1962.
    Green sparred with Liston at the race track training camp in September, 1962.
    Green was provided as a courtesy sparring partner by the connected Chicago-crew.

    LeRoy fought on the 9/25 Patterson vs. Liston undercard,,,,,,,,vs. Allen Thomas
